What is a remote RF engineer?

A Remote RF Engineer is a professional who designs, analyzes, and optimizes radio frequency (RF) systems while working remotely. They focus on tasks such as network planning, signal analysis, interference mitigation, and equipment testing for industries like telecommunications, aerospace, and defense. Using specialized software and tools, they ensure effective wireless communication without being physically present at a work site. This role requires knowledge of RF principles, antenna design, and wireless standards. Strong problem-solving skills and experience with RF simulation tools are essential for success in this position.

What are the typical daily responsibilities of a remote RF engineer?

As a Remote RF Engineer, your daily responsibilities often include designing, simulating, and testing RF circuits and systems, diagnosing performance issues, and optimizing wireless networks from a remote location. You may collaborate virtually with cross-functional teams, prepare technical reports, and participate in project meetings. Many remote RF Engineers also support field teams by analyzing remote test data and providing guidance on troubleshooting. The role requires strong self-discipline and proactive communication to ensure timely project delivery and effective teamwork.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a remote RF engineer?

To thrive as a Remote RF Engineer, you need a strong background in radio frequency theory, wireless communication, circuit design, and a relevant engineering degree. Familiarity with RF simulation tools (such as CST, HFSS, or ADS), spectrum analyzers, and certifications like a Professional Engineer (PE) license or relevant vendor certifications are highly valued. Excellent problem-solving, self-management, and clear written and verbal communication skills distinguish top candidates. These skills are crucial as RF Engineers must independently analyze, design, and troubleshoot complex wireless systems while effectively collaborating with distributed teams.

What We Are Looking For
  • High school diploma required, or GED required, Associates or Bachelors degree
  • RF, or equivalent Engineering degree preferred
  • Certified PMP preferred
  • RCDD certification preferred
  • iBwave Design Certification (L1 and/or L2 required)
  • GROLL FCC License required
  • OSHA 10 or 30 preferred
  • Minimum 8 years experience in wireless communication and telecommunications project management
  • Experienced with carrier RF system design and optimization practices
  • Thorough knowledge of DAS technology, architecture, fiber design and deployment requirements
  • Provide commissioning efforts for in building Cell DAS deployments with various DAS technologies and manufacturers
  • Knowledge of data infrastructure industry including technology, quality and safety standards
